    Abstract: A bidirectional out-of-band management (OOBM) dongle comprises a serial port for receiving console traffic from a console port of a managed switch and an Ethernet port for receiving management port traffic from a management port of the managed switch. In operation, the OOBM dongle multiplexes, via an optional adapter, the console traffic and the management port traffic and generates Ethernet traffic that is then communicated, via an OOBM port on the dongle, to an OOBM switch port of an OOBM switch that acts as a power sourcing device for the OOBM dongle.

    Abstract: A switch component secure upgrade system includes a dual-ported switch component, a central processing system that is connected to the switch component via the components read-only port, and a management controller system that is connected to the switch component via the components read-write port. The management controller system receives a component upgrade request that is encrypted with a management controller public key, decrypts the component upgrade request using a management controller private key, and validates the component upgrade request, which is signed with a release management private key, using a release management public key. In response to validating the component upgrade request, the management controller system validates a component upgrade payload that is included in the component upgrade request and, in response, upgrades the switch component via the read-write port using the component upgrade payload.

    Abstract: Disclosed systems and methods provide an integrated hypermedia engine (IHE) that monitors and predicts user activity on spawned document windows and spliced network management CLI/GUI sessions. In embodiments, the IHE pro-actively assists a user to efficiently use device-related documentation in an intuitive manner that requires minimal user interaction and, thereby, reduces the likelihood of human error, e.g., when configuring network devices involves multi-tiered, dynamic configuration paths. The IHE may acts as bridge between document windows and spliced network management sessions, for example, to enable seamless transfer of a CLI command from a document window to an inline GUI panel launched by a CLI session when constructing a command line. In embodiments, a context-ware THE may create and take advantage of documentation tags by interpreting relationships between commands to enable auto-navigation of the document.

    Abstract: A transceiver device port configuration and monitoring system includes a networking device having a networking device wireless communication system, a port, and a wireless identification system associated with the port. A transceiver device is connected to the port and includes a wireless reader system that retrieves a port identifier for the port from the wireless identification system, and a transceiver device wireless communication system that the transceiver device uses to wirelessly advertise the connection of the transceiver device to the port. In response to receiving the wireless advertisement of the connection of the transceiver device to the port, the networking device uses the networking device wireless communication system to establish a wireless session with the transceiver device, retrieves configuration information from the transceiver device via the wireless session, uses the configuration information to configure the port for operation with the transceiver device, and monitors the port.

    Abstract: A content sharing system for peer-to-peer private sharing of digital content between users of a sharing platform is configured, using application programs executing on the users' mobile devices, so that the content can only be used (e.g., viewed, shared, etc.) by the receiver from within an instance of the application executing on an authorized receiving device, and only if the owner has set permissions allowing the receiver to perform the requested action. The owner can modify these permissions and promulgate the changes to the platform users via the network of user devices, causing the applications of impacted users to allow or deny activity, and keep or discard data, accordingly. Further, each transaction involving the shared content can be recorded to each parties' private or synchronized shared ledgers, creating a complete interaction timeline that essentially bestows the content with “memory” of how it has been shared.

    Abstract: A configuration support system includes a support device having an automated support application, a network device, and a management device coupled to the network device and the support device. The management device creates a configuration session with the network device and, in response, displays a configuration window. The management device also creates a messaging session with the automated support application and, in response, displays a messaging window. The management device may then send, to the automated support application via the messaging session, data generated during the configuration session. The management device may also receive, from the automated support application via the messaging session, an automated support application command directed to the network device and execute, on the network device via the configuration session, the automated support application command.

    Abstract: A field replaceable unit authentication system provides for a field replaceable unit device to be positioned in a chassis. A trusted platform module is included in the field replaceable unit device. A network operating system engine may be provided in the field replaceable unit device and coupled to the trusted platform module. The network operating system engine participates in a boot process with a booting subsystem to generate current boot metric data that is provided for storage in the trusted platform module. A platform management controller in the field replaceable unit device retrieves the current boot metric data from the trusted platform module, authenticates the trusted platform module, and compares the current boot metric data to previously stored boot metric data to determine whether to authenticate the network operating system engine. If authenticated, the network operating system engine then authenticates the platform management controller.

    Abstract: A port monitoring system includes a networking device that includes a device port and a monitoring device that includes a display. The networking device captures port indicator data that is associated with the operation of the device port, timestamps the port indicator data, and wirelessly transmits the port indicator data to the monitoring device. The monitoring device wirelessly receives the port indicator data from the networking device and determines whether the timestamp on the port indicator data satisfies a timing requirement for displaying a port indication. If the timestamp satisfies the timing requirement, the monitoring device provides a graphical user interface on the display that includes a graphical port indicator that operates according to the port indicator data. As such, real-time isochronous port indicator data may be wirelessly transmitted and displayed graphically on a monitoring device that allows a user to easily monitor port indicators on networking devices.

    Abstract: A system and method for network element management includes a management window, a scroll buffer configured to store commands and responses, a console pane displayed in the management window and displaying a portion of the scroll buffer, and data structures. The system connects to a network element associated with network objects using a network, accept commands in the console pane, parse the commands, send the commands to the network element, receive and parse responses from the network element, update the data structures based on the commands and responses, create hot spots in the scroll buffer based on the commands and responses, spawn a GUI dialog based on a first network object associated with a first hot spot when the first hot spot is activated, and provide copies of first data structures selected from the data structures to the GUI dialog. The first data structures are associated with the first network object.
